专利名称: |
自主车辆的回退请求 |
摘要: |
本发明涉及一种具有存储器(130)、用于控制车辆(100)的多个自驾驶系统(160‑172)、以及一个或多个处理器(120)的系统。处理器被配置为接收与对主任务的请求相关联的至少一个回退任务和每个后退任务的至少一个触发器。每个触发器都是条件的集合,当条件被满足时,指示车辆何时要求注意适当操作。处理器还被配置为向自驾驶系统发送指令以执行主任务并从自驾驶系统接收状态更新。处理器被配置为基于状态更新来确定触发器的条件的集合被满足,并且基于相关联的回退任务将进一步的指令发送到自驾驶系统。 |
专利类型: |
发明专利 |
国家地区组织代码: |
美国;US |
申请人: |
伟摩有限责任公司 |
发明人: |
J.S.赫巴赫;P.内梅克;N.费尔菲尔德 |
专利状态: |
有效 |
申请日期: |
2016-05-23T00:00:00+0800 |
发布日期: |
2019-08-23T00:00:00+0800 |
申请号: |
CN201910415237.9 |
公开号: |
CN110155083A |
代理机构: |
北京市柳沈律师事务所 |
代理人: |
金玉洁 |
分类号: |
B60W50/029(2012.01);B;B60;B60W;B60W50 |
申请人地址: |
美国加利福尼亚州 |
主权项: |
1.一种包括一个或多个处理器的系统,所述系统被配置为: 在存储器中存储至少一个回退任务和用于每个回退任务的对应的触发器,每个触发器是条件的集合,当所述条件被满足时,指示相应的回退任务应当被执行; 从控制车辆的一个或多个自驾驶系统接收状态更新; 至少部分地基于所述状态更新来确定给定回退任务的给定的对应的触发器的条件的集合被满足;以及 基于所述给定的回退任务向自驾驶系统发送一个或多个指令。 2.根据权利要求1所述的系统,其中,所述至少一个触发器包括以下各项中的至少一个: 预定的燃料或能量水平, 所述一个或多个处理器与远程服务器之间的连接的丢失, 缺少用于执行的任务,或者 车辆的安排的维修。 3.根据权利要求1所述的系统,其中: 基位置被硬编码在所述存储器上; 所述一个或多个处理器进一步被配置为确定与所述触发器相关联的回退任务是不可执行的;以及 将回退任务更新为驾驶到基位置。 4.根据权利要求1所述的系统,其中,所述一个或多个处理器还被配置为: 基于来自所述自驾驶系统的状态更新来发送状态更新报告; 接收至少一个更新的回退任务;以及 将所述至少一个更新的回退任务存储在存储器中。 5.根据权利要求4所述的系统,其中所述一个或多个处理器进一步被配置为基于所述至少一个更新的回退任务来更新至少一个回退任务。 6.根据权利要求1所述的系统,其中所述一个或多个处理器进一步被配置为: 确定所述触发器的条件的集合不再被满足;并且 当所述触发器的一个或多个条件被确定为不再被满足时,向一个或多个自驾驶系统发送指令的第二集合以自主地恢复主任务。 7.根据权利要求1所述的系统,其中,所述一个或多个处理器还被配置为: 确定所述触发器的紧急性级别,所述紧急性级别与在所述触发器的条件的集合被满足之后与所述触发器相关联的回退任务多快被执行有关;并且 当所述触发器的紧急性级别为某一级别时,在主任务完成之前发送所述一个或多个指令。 8.根据权利要求1所述的系统,其中,所述一个或多个指令包括使得所述自驾驶系统停止执行所述主任务的指令。 9.根据权利要求1所述的系统,其中所述一个或多个处理器进一步被配置为通过访问每个触发器与对应的回退任务的映射来确定哪个回退任务与所述触发器相关联。 10.根据权利要求1所述的系统,还包括所述车辆。 11.根据权利要求10所述的系统,其中,如果基位置未被存储在所述存储器上,则所述车辆将不启动。 12.一种包括服务器的车队管理系统,被配置为: 发送和接收与能够自主驾驶的多个车辆的操作有关的数据;并且 将调度命令发送到车辆中的一个,所述调度命令包括至少一个回退任务、对应于每个回退任务的至少一个触发器,每个触发器是条件的集合,当所述条件被满足时,指示对应的回退任务应该被执行并指示对应的回退任务应该多快被执行。 13.根据权利要求12所述的系统,其中,所述服务器还被配置为响应于所接收到的更新来发送至少一个更新的回退任务。 14.根据权利要求12所述的系统,其中所述紧急性级别与在所述触发器的条件的集合被满足之后多快地执行与所述触发器相关联的回退任务有关。 15.根据权利要求12所述的系统,其中,所述服务器还被配置为确定在执行至少一个回退任务时所述车辆中的一个车辆可以驾驶到的一个或多个回退位置;并且 其中所述调度命令还包括所述一个或多个回退位置。 16.根据权利要求12所述的系统,还包括能够自主驾驶的多个车辆。 17.一种方法,包括: 由一个或多个处理器在存储器中存储至少一个回退任务和用于每个回退任务的对应的触发器,每个对应的触发器是条件的集合,当所述条件被满足时,指示对应的回退任务应该被执行; 由所述一个或多个处理器从控制车辆的一个或多个自驾驶系统接收状态更新; 由所述一个或多个处理器至少部分地基于所述状态更新来确定用于给定的回退任务的给定的对应的触发器的条件的集合被满足;以及 由所述一个或多个处理器基于所述给定的回退任务向所述自驾驶系统中的一个发送一个或多个指令。 18.根据权利要求17所述的方法,还包括: 由所述一个或多个处理器确定所述给定的对应的触发器的紧急性级别,所述紧急性级别与在所述给定的对应的触发器的条件的集合被满足之后与所述给定的对应的触发器相关联的给定的回退任务多快被执行有关; 其中所述一个或多个指令包括停止执行所述主任务的指令。 19.根据权利要求17所述的方法,还包括由所述一个或多个处理器通过访问每个触发器与一个或多个对应的回退任务的映射,来确定哪个回退任务与所述给定的对应的触发器相关联。 20.根据权利要求17所述的方法,还包括: 由所述一个或多个处理器确定所述触发器的条件的集合不再被满足;以及 当确定所述触发器的一个或多个条件不再被满足时,由所述一个或多个处理器向自驾驶系统发送指令的第二集合以自主地恢复所述主任务。 |
所属类别: |
发明专利 |